reconstruction kernel
Mathematical filter applied during CT image reconstruction. Sharp kernels (bone, lung) emphasize edges and high-frequency content at the cost of more noise; smooth kernels (soft tissue, brain) reduce noise at the cost of edge sharpness. Protocol-specific selection is the standard workflow.
Why it matters to buyers: Protocol-specific. A chest CT uses different kernels for lung windows vs mediastinum — same raw acquisition, different recon kernel, different displayed series.
Why it matters to engineers: User-selectable per protocol. Reconstructed images from the same raw scan with different kernels are stored as separate DICOM series. Kernel choice interacts with iterative recon tier and DL recon settings.
